Course Goal / Objective
The aim of this course is to explain the methods that investigate soil biota, the enzymes produced in the soil, the distribution of microbial organisms, and the transformation of organic matter.
Course Content
This course covers soil habitats and biota, as well as how the activities of this biota can be detected.

Course Learning Outcomes
Order | Course Learning Outcomes |
---|---|
LO01 | Student summarizes the fundamental physical and chemical properties of the soil. |
LO02 | Student summarizes the basic structures and metabolisms of bacteria and archaea, which are the most important organisms of the soil microflora living in the soil. |
LO03 | Student summarizes the life and ecology of fungi living in the soil. |
LO04 | Student summarizes the biodiversity of the fauna living in the soil and their roles in ecosystem functions. |
LO05 | Student presents the physiological methods used in the investigation of soil biota and their functions. |
LO06 | Student presents present the biochemical methods used in the investigation of soil biota and their functions. |
LO07 | Student applies scientific research methods used in the carbon cycle in soil, the dynamics of organic matter, and its formation. |
LO08 | Student summarizes the scientific research methods used in nitrogen mineralization and immobilization in the soil. |
